Cremona's table of elliptic curves

Curve 14016n1

14016 = 26 · 3 · 73



Data for elliptic curve 14016n1

Field Data Notes
Atkin-Lehner 2+ 3+ 73- Signs for the Atkin-Lehner involutions
Class 14016n Isogeny class
Conductor 14016 Conductor
∏ cp 8 Product of Tamagawa factors cp
deg 10240 Modular degree for the optimal curve
Δ 7847165952 = 214 · 38 · 73 Discriminant
Eigenvalues 2+ 3+ -2  4  4 -2  2  4 Hecke eigenvalues for primes up to 20
Equation [0,-1,0,-529,-1775] [a1,a2,a3,a4,a6]
j 1001132368/478953 j-invariant
L 2.0871791690665 L(r)(E,1)/r!
Ω 1.0435895845332 Real period
R 1 Regulator
r 0 Rank of the group of rational points
S 1 (Analytic) order of Ш
t 2 Number of elements in the torsion subgroup
Twists 14016cc1 1752k1 42048ba1 Quadratic twists by: -4 8 -3
